RATA: [ GLSA 200711-20 Pioneers: Multiple Denials of Service

Posted by Bob on: 11/29/2007 11:25 PM [ Print | 0 comment(s) ]

A new security update has been released for Gentoo Linux - Pioneers: Multiple Denials of Service. Here the announcement:




Gentoo Linux Security Advisory [ERRATA UPDATE] GLSA 200711-20:04
- -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- -
http://security.gentoo.org/
- -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- -

Severity: Normal
Title: Pioneers: Multiple Denials of Service
Date: November 14, 2007
Updated: November 29, 2007
Bugs: #198807
ID: 200711-20:04

- -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- -

Errata
======

The fixed ebuild proposed in the original version of this Security
Advisory did not address all the vulnerabilities of the Pioneers package.
All users of the Pioneers package should upgrade to
games-board/pioneers-0.11.3-r1.

The corrected sections appear below.

Synopsis
========

Two Denial of Service vulnerabilities were discovered in Pioneers.


Affected packages
=================

-------------------------------------------------------------------
Package / Vulnerable / Unaffected
-------------------------------------------------------------------
1 games-board/pioneers lt; 0.11.3-r1 gt;= 0.11.3-r1

Description
===========

Roland Clobus discovered that the Pioneers server may free sessions
objects while they are still in use, resulting in access to invalid
memory zones (CVE-2007-5933). Bas Wijnen discovered an error when
closing connections which can lead to a failed assertion
(CVE-2007-6010).

Resolution
==========

All Pioneers users should upgrade to the latest version:

# emerge --sync
# emerge --ask --oneshot --verbose "gt;=games-board/pioneers-0.11.3-r1"
